cigi-ccl-examples: compiled examples for the CIGI class library (CCL)

 This package contains compiled examples for the CIGI class library
 (CCL). The primary goal of the Common Image Generator Interface
 (CIGI) standard is to standardise the interface between a simulators
 host computer and the Image Generator. The CCL is a C++ language
 library for implementing CIGI in both host and IG applications.
 .
 Some features of the CCL include:
 .
  * Handles packing, unpacking, and byte swapping automatically
  * Handles output buffer management
  * Can handle most of the input buffer management with simple calls
  * Can translate between different versions of CIGI
